New York, NY (Top40 Charts) History-making Hip-Hop icon, Cardi B, has released the highly anticipated video for hit track, "Be Careful" off her #1 debut album "Invasion of Privacy." The video, directed by Jora Frantzis, is the follow up to last month's video for "Bartier Cardi (feat. 21 Savage)" directed by famed artist Petra Collins, which has since amassed over 19 million views. "Invasion Of Privacy" instantly broke records with the biggest ever first week streams for a debut album and female artist as well as topping the Billboard 200 chart, Top R&B/Hip-Hop Albums chart, Top Rap Albums and Top Digital Album charts. The acclaimed album entered the record books at the 5th largest streaming debut of all time. Additionally, last night saw Cardi B take home the award for Top Rap Female Artist at the Billboard Music Awards.

"INVASION OF PRIVACY" - which includes the 5x RIAA platinum certified classic, "Bodak Yellow," alongside the platinum certified smash, "Bartier Cardi (feat. 21 Savage)," standout favorites like "Be Careful" and "I Like It," featuring Bad Bunny and J Balvin and a spectacular lineup of featured appearances from Chance The Rapper, SZA, Kehlani, Migos, and YG - has drawn critical acclaim around the world to match its remarkable popular success. "INVASION OF PRIVACY" "is lavishly emotional, intimately personal, wildly funny," announced Rolling Stone in its four-starred rave. "Still, there's no question whose album this is. Funny, fierce, foul-mouthed and in-your-face, "Invasion of Privacy" is one of the most powerful debuts of this millennium," declared Variety. "The 25-year-old's debut album shows off her hard work, versatility and ambition, mixing quick-jab rhymes with the enthusiasm and charm that have made her a star," raves The New York Times. Pitchfork summed it up best: "Cardi B's remarkable debut places her, without a doubt, in the pantheon of great rappers. It is both brazen and vulnerable, filled with wild amounts of personality, style, and craft."

The 2x GRAMMY Award-nominated superstar recently made her stunning Met Gala debut alongside designer and friend Jeremy Scott. Furthermore, Cardi celebrated the arrival of "Invasion Of Privacy" with a number of high profile TV appearances and performances, first joining host Chadwick Boseman as the musical guest on Saturday Night Live, followed by The TonightShow Starring Jimmy Fallon, where she served as both musical guest and the first-ever co-host in show history. In addition, Cardi appeared as a guest on an episode of The Ellen DeGeneres Show.

Cardi B is now getting set to embark on a series of hugely anticipated live concert performances, which kicked off with her debut at Indio, CA's Coachella Valley Music & Arts Festival. Cardi will join Bruno Mars on the upcoming final leg of his epic 24K Magic World Tour, with dates beginning September 7th at Denver, CO's and culminating with a four-night-stand at Los Angeles, CA's STAPLES Center on October 23rd, 24th, 26th, and 27th.
